#172374 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#172374 is composed of 9% red, 13.7%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 69.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 232.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 27.3%. #172374 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e46e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#172374 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#172374 has RGB values of R:23, G:35,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 1516404.

Shades and Tints of #172374
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f0f2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#172374
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424349 is the less saturated color, while #021389 is the most saturated one.
